#ce031c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#ce031c is composed of 80.8% red, 1.2% green and 11%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 98.5% magenta, 86.4% yellow and 19.2% black. It has a hue angle of 352.6 degrees, a saturation of 97.1% and a lightness of 41%. #ce031c color hex could be obtained by blending #ff0638 with #9d0000. Closest websafe color is: #cc0033.

Shades and Tints of #ce031c
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0d0002 is the darkest color, while #fff8f9 is the lightest one.

Tones of #ce031c
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#6e6365 is the less saturated color, while #ce031c is the most saturated one.
